France Hardware : Forums de discussion
Retrouvez les prix près de chez vous :  
Index du forum | Liste des membres | Liste des groupes | Inscription | F-A-Q | Recherche
Pseudo :    Password :     
23 039 membres enregistrés - 1 896 564 posts - 97 408 topics
Index des forums FH  | Index des forums DegroupNews
      Programmation
           Langages Web
                [MySQL / shell] aide maintenance mysql suite a migration d'appli de postgres vers mysql
16 connectés(record : 207 le 05 juin 2007 - 05 h 23)

Vous devez vous connecter pour répondre au topic.
[MySQL / shell] aide maintenance mysql suite a migration d'appli de postgres vers mysql

grabber
Coordinateur
MacBook Pro 2,4 Powered

Messages : 8 590
Inscrit le 06/03/02
Ville : Angers
Non connecté
  Posté le 21 mai 2007 - 10 h 19 m 53 s
hello,

voici mon leger probleme, pas tres complique mais entre nous j'ai pas le temps de chercher pour l'instant.

alors j'ai une appli en postgresql que j'ai migre (enfin c en cours) sur un nouveau dedie avec mysql 5. mise a part les conversions de type etc, sur lesquelles je suis entrain de me prendre le chou, j'ai un script de sauvegarde de mes bases que j'aimerais modifier pour l'adapter a mysql.

pour l'instant, mon script fait un dump toutes les nuits de mes bases. ensuite, il conserve 7 exemplaires et fait un roulement la dessus. avant de faire la sauvegarde, je faisais un vacuum et un reindex de mes bases.

je voudrais faire ca en version mysql mais je suis pas a fond sur mysql en ligned e commande :lol:

voila un exemple de mon shell code pour pg :
- suppression de la svg la plus vieille : rm -f /var/dumps/dump.baseXX-7;
- renommage des 6 autres pour le cyclage : -6 devient-7, -5 devient -6, ... tout ca avec un mv
- dump de la base du jour : /usr/local/pgsql/bin/pg_dump baseXX > /var/dumps/dump.baseXX;
- mon vacuum : /usr/local/pgsql/bin/psql -c "vacuum verbose analyze" baseXX >vacuum.log
- mon reindex : /usr/local/pgsql/bin/psql -c "reindex database" baseXX >reindex.log

voila, jveu la meme chose pour mysql pour le coller dans un cron :jap:

amis mysqliens, a vous de jouer :)

merci d'avance



:firefox:

defrance
PI-nary rules

Messages : 710
Inscrit le 05/09/03
Ville : Lyon
Non connecté
  Posté le 22 mai 2007 - 00 h 37 m 52 s
hello grabber, pourquoi tu n'utilises pas un langage plus avancé genre python?



La connerie c'est la décontraction de l'esprit, c'est pour cela que de temps en temps je m'autorise à faire le con.
Serge Gainsbourg


grabber
Coordinateur
MacBook Pro 2,4 Powered

Messages : 8 590
Inscrit le 06/03/02
Ville : Angers
Non connecté
  Posté le 22 mai 2007 - 15 h 30 m 13 s
bah parce que j'en ai pas besoin :)
j'ai que des copies de fichiers a faire en les renommant, ce qui se fait avec mv tout simplement.
ensuite, j'ai juste a lancer le vacuum et le reindex qui se fait aussi en ligne de commande donc bon, je vois pas trop l'interet de faire du python...

expliques moi ton idee car je connais pas trop python, qu'est ce que cela apporterait de plus ? fait il la totale d'un coup avec une instruction ?

++



:firefox:

grabber
Coordinateur
MacBook Pro 2,4 Powered

Messages : 8 590
Inscrit le 06/03/02
Ville : Angers
Non connecté
  Posté le 22 mai 2007 - 15 h 49 m 39 s
bon j'ai la reponse pour le vacuum, il n'y a pas de vacuum en mysql :jap:

la suite arrive...



:firefox:

Page genérée en 6.3221 secondes par RahForum 2.0 | Gzip off |  Stats |  Metaforums |  RSS
© 2004 Cerbere Systems.
Prix Matériel Informatique | Informatique Lyon | Informatique Grenoble | Informatique Annecy | Informatique Marseille | Informatique Bordeaux | Forum Informatique
ADSL |Actualité ADSL | e-commerce | Commande Au Volant
Creative Commons
Message Boards and Forums Directory